Spring Vegetable Paella

Paella is a delicious thing - and is also a deliciously easy thing to make at home in a pan. Is particularly good served with some sliced tomatoes, onions, parsley and a big wedge of lemon.

Ingredients

  • 250g Bomba Paella Rice
  • 900 ml Chicken or Veg Stock
  • 1 Onion
  • 1 Leek
  • 1 Courgette
  • 1 or 2 Yellow Pepper/s
  • Broccoli or Spinach Leaves
  • 5 Cloves Garlic
  • Glass White Wine
  • Parsley (to serve)
  • Lemon (to serve)

Wash and slice the Onion, Pepper, Leek, Courgette

Wash the Broccoli or Spinach

[I used Broccoli from my garden... it was very small and thin! Spinach or Kale would be a good substitute for such weedy Broccoli... OR you could slice bigger Broccoli into slices that don't need much cooking...]

Crush or finely chop the Garlic

In a frying pan (30cm ish) – heat some Olive Oil and gently fry the Onions, Peppers, Leeks and Courgettes for 10 – 20 minutes – stirring a lot until they are soft and sweet.  Add the Garlic and cook for a few more minutes.  Add the glass of White Wine, and cook off the alcohol…

[At this point you can either keep the Onion mixture (Sofrito) until later - or you can go on to cook the Paella, which takes 20 mins from now on!]

Stir in the Bomba Rice, coating it in the Oil from the Sofrito.  Carefully add 900ml of good quality Chicken or Veg Stock and bring to the boil (season with Salt & Pepper now)

On a medium heat, cook for 15 mins or until there is only a little liquid around the Rice, and the bottom is sticking slightly (might even sound crunchy).  Don’t stir whilst cooking – but do test the Rice after 15 mins to make sure it is cooked but with some bite left (it could have a couple more minutes on the heat if not cooked yet)

When done, turn off the heat, squash the Broccoli or Spinach leaves into the top of the Paella and leave to stand for 3 – 5 minutes.  By this stage, the Rice will be deliciously cooked and your greens will have wilted.  Sprinkle chopped Parsley over everything and enjoy!

Serve this healthy Paella with a large wedge of Lemon or Lime and Tomatoes in whatever form you fancy… sliced, with coriander or with chopped onion too
